At Pendleton, we take pride in our legacy—with over 150 years of craftsmanship and quality woven into everything we do. Our store leaders play a vital role in shaping the customer experience and driving our continued success. As a Store Manager, you’ll lead a passionate team, drive business results, and foster an environment rooted in connection, authenticity, and excellence.
We are currently seeking a professional and results-driven full-time Store Manager for our Napa , CA store location.

What You’ll Do
Lead all store operations to drive sales, profitability, and outstanding customer serviceRecruit, hire, train, and develop a high-performing team of assistant managers and sales associatesSet daily, weekly, and long-term goals to meet or exceed financial and operational targetsExecute business strategies and local marketing efforts to increase revenue and customer engagementMaintain operational excellence in inventory accuracy, visual merchandising, and loss preventionEnsure compliance with all company policies, safety standards, and operational proceduresMonitor and analyze sales metrics (UPT, ADS, conversion), and take proactive actionsConduct performance reviews, provide ongoing feedback, and support employee developmentCommunicate regularly with Area Managers and internal teams to align on priorities and performanceTake ownership of budget management and store expense controlParticipate in company-wide projects and initiatives as neededWhat We’re Looking For
Bachelor’s degree and 3+ years of retail sales & customer service leadership experience preferred(or 7+ years of retail management experience in lieu of a degree)
Proven ability to lead teams, drive sales, and exceed goalsStrong communication, coaching, and conflict resolution skillsHighly organized and analytical, with the ability to manage multiple prioritiesExperience with financial statements, payroll budgets, and performance metricsTech-comfortable : pro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, Publisher), POS systems, inventory / order software, and video conferencing toolsFlexible schedule including weekends, evenings, and holidaysWillingness to travel as needed for meetings, training, or store supportAble to meet physical demands of retail including lifting up to 40 lbs., standing / walking for extended periods, and occasional ladder useAbout Pendleton
